Factors to Consider When Choosing Private Health Insurance
Before we get into the best health insurance providers, let’s look at the critical factors to keep in mind when selecting a plan for your family.
Coverage Options
Every family has unique healthcare needs. Some may need comprehensive coverage that includes everything from routine checkups to major surgeries, while others may prioritize specific areas such as dental or maternity care. Look carefully at the coverage details of any plan and ensure it aligns with your family’s requirements.
Ask yourself these questions:
- Does the plan cover family wellness visits and preventative care?
- Are there provisions for maternity and pediatric care?
- How comprehensive is the coverage for chronic or preexisting conditions?
Cost and Affordability
The cost of health insurance is more than just the monthly premium. Consider additional costs such as deductibles, co-pays, and out-of-pocket maximums. A plan with a lower premium might have higher deductibles, which could result in unexpected expenses.
Pro tip: Calculate the total annual cost of any plan, including premiums and estimated out-of-pocket expenses, to get a realistic idea of affordability.
Network of Providers
Does the plan provide access to a wide network of healthcare professionals, specialists, and hospitals? Ensure that your preferred medical providers and facilities are included in the plan’s network, as out-of-network care often comes with significantly higher costs.
Family-Specific Needs
Every family is different. Are you a young family planning for more children? Are you managing a household with multiple medical conditions? Tailor your choice to meet these specialized needs. Look for plans that offer flexibility and cater to growing families or those with specific medical requirements.
Top Private Health Insurance Providers for Families in 2025
To save you time, we’ve rounded up the leading private health insurance providers that cater to families in 2025. Each offers a mix of comprehensive coverage, competitive pricing, and added benefits.
1. Blue Cross Blue Shield (BCBS) Family Plan
Blue Cross Blue Shield is a well-established provider offering extensive coverage through an expansive network of healthcare professionals.
- Benefits: Comprehensive coverage for routine care, specialist visits, and emergency services. Many plans include telemedicine options.
- Costs: Mid-range premiums with manageable deductibles. Flexible plans available based on family size and individual needs.
- Limitations: Some plans may have limited out-of-network coverage.
2. UnitedHealthcare Family Plan
UnitedHealthcare is known for its user-friendly approach and extensive coverage options.
- Benefits: Includes 24/7 virtual visits, robust wellness programs, and integrated tools to help you manage claims and benefits.
- Costs: Slightly higher premiums but lower deductibles, making it great for families with frequent healthcare needs.
- Limitations: Limited plan options in certain states.
3. Aetna Family Advantage Plan
Aetna blends affordability with great coverage, making it a prime choice for budget-conscious families.
- Benefits: Preventative care services are often covered 100%. Flexible Health Savings Account (HSA) options are available.
- Costs: Low to moderate premiums, making it highly attractive for families on a budget.
- Limitations: Coverage may be less comprehensive for specific treatments.
4. Kaiser Permanente Family Plan
Kaiser Permanente is an excellent choice for families seeking integrated healthcare services.
- Benefits: Offers holistic care through its exclusive network of hospitals and providers. Many plans include mental health and wellness coverage.
- Costs: Competitive premiums that vary by region.
- Limitations: Coverage is generally restricted to Kaiser facilities and providers.
5. Cigna Family Care Plan
Cigna is a global leader, offering exceptional family-focused plans.
- Benefits: Wide array of plans tailored to families. Offers some of the best coverage for dental and vision care.
- Costs: Moderate premiums with flexible deductible options.
- Limitations: Some benefits only available to those enrolled in top-tier plans.

Expert Tips for Maximizing Health Insurance Benefits
To ensure you get the most out of your private health insurance, consider these tips from healthcare experts and financial advisors:
- Understand Your Policy: Familiarize yourself with your plan’s benefits and exclusions. Knowing the boundaries of your coverage can save you from unexpected expenses.
- Leverage Preventive Care: Most plans cover preventative services like annual checkups and immunizations at no extra cost. Use these benefits regularly to keep your family healthy.
- Set Up an HSA or FSA: If your plan offers a Health Savings Account (HSA) or Flexible Spending Account (FSA), take advantage of it to save on medical expenses with pre-tax dollars.
- Keep Track of Claims: Stay organized with your claims and benefit usage. Many insurers offer mobile apps to track expenses and submit claims efficiently.
- Shop Smart for Prescriptions: Use your insurer’s pharmacy network or mail-order options for prescription drugs to save on costs.
